Historical Roots and the Genesis of Crypto Communities: From Cypherpunks to Bitcoin's Inception
The genesis of crypto culture and community can be traced back to the cypherpunk movement of the late 1980s and early 1990s. This nascent community, primarily composed of cryptographers, programmers, and privacy advocates, coalesced around the shared belief in the transformative power of cryptography to safeguard individual liberties in the burgeoning digital age. Key figures such as Timothy May, John Gilmore, and Eric Hughes laid the intellectual groundwork through manifestos and online discussions, articulating the need for and potential of cryptographic tools to ensure privacy and anonymity in electronic interactions. Their foundational document, "The Cypherpunk Manifesto," written by Eric Hughes in 1993, is often cited as a cornerstone of crypto-libertarian thought, proclaiming that "Privacy is necessary for an open society in the electronic age." This manifesto explicitly advocated for the widespread adoption of strong cryptography as a means to empower individuals against unwarranted surveillance and control, setting the stage for future crypto communities.
The Cypherpunks were not merely theorists; they actively engaged in developing and disseminating cryptographic software, including PGP (Pretty Good Privacy), a program for encrypting and decrypting emails and files, authored by Phil Zimmermann. This practical approach was crucial in demonstrating the real-world applicability of cryptographic principles and fostering a culture of technological innovation within the community. Their primary mode of communication and collaboration was through mailing lists, a precursor to modern online forums, where they debated technical challenges, philosophical implications, and political ramifications of cryptography. The Cypherpunks mailing list served as an incubator for ideas that would later become central to the cryptocurrency movement, including concepts like digital cash, decentralized systems, and cryptographic anonymity. According to Peter Ludlow's book "Crypto Anarchy, Cyberstates, and Pirate Utopias" (2001), the Cypherpunk movement can be seen as a direct intellectual ancestor to the cryptocurrency movement, providing both the ideological impetus and the technological building blocks.
The transition from the Cypherpunk ethos to the concrete realization of cryptocurrency took a significant leap forward with the publication of the Bitcoin whitepaper by Satoshi Nakamoto in 2008. This document, titled "Bitcoin: A Peer-to-Peer Electronic Cash System," outlined a novel approach to digital currency, leveraging cryptographic principles to create a decentralized, trustless, and censorship-resistant payment system. Nakamoto's invention built upon decades of research in cryptography, distributed systems, and digital currencies, drawing inspiration from earlier attempts at digital cash, such as David Chaum's DigiCash and Wei Dai's b-money, but overcoming their limitations through a combination of blockchain technology and proof-of-work consensus mechanisms. The whitepaper was initially disseminated through a cryptography mailing list, echoing the Cypherpunk tradition of knowledge sharing and open collaboration.
The immediate aftermath of the Bitcoin whitepaper's release saw the formation of the first true cryptocurrency community centered around the Bitcoin project. This community initially consisted of cryptographers, programmers, and early adopters who were intrigued by the technical and ideological promises of Bitcoin. The BitcoinTalk forum, launched in 2009, became the primary online gathering place for this nascent community. As documented by Sarah Meiklejohn et al. in their 2013 paper "A Fistful of Bitcoins: Characterizing Payments Among Men with No Names," early Bitcoin users were drawn to the cryptocurrency for a variety of reasons, including ideological alignment with Cypherpunk principles, technological curiosity, and the potential for financial speculation. The early Bitcoin community was characterized by a strong sense of shared purpose, driven by the belief in Bitcoin's potential to disrupt traditional financial systems and empower individuals globally. Andreas Antonopoulos, in his book "Mastering Bitcoin" (2014), emphasizes the importance of this early community in nurturing Bitcoin's growth, contributing to its codebase, evangelizing its adoption, and defending it against early criticisms and attacks.
The early culture within the Bitcoin community was heavily influenced by the Cypherpunk ethos, emphasizing decentralization, privacy, open-source development, and resistance to censorship. Hal Finney, one of the earliest adopters and contributors to Bitcoin, exemplified this spirit, actively participating in the BitcoinTalk forum and contributing significantly to the early codebase. Gavin Andresen, who succeeded Satoshi Nakamoto as the lead developer of Bitcoin, also played a crucial role in maintaining and expanding the community, fostering a culture of open collaboration and technical rigor. The early Bitcoin community was relatively small and technically oriented, with a strong focus on the technical aspects of the protocol and its underlying cryptography. According to a study by Primavera De Filippi and Aaron Wright in their book "Blockchain and the Law" (2018), this technical focus was instrumental in ensuring the robustness and security of the Bitcoin network in its formative years. The community's commitment to open-source principles and collaborative development laid the foundation for the subsequent growth and diversification of the broader cryptocurrency ecosystem.
The Proliferation of Altcoins and the Fragmentation of Crypto Communities: Diversification and Specialization
The initial years following Bitcoin's launch witnessed a period of relative homogeneity within the cryptocurrency space, with Bitcoin dominating both in terms of market capitalization and community attention. However, as the potential of blockchain technology and cryptocurrencies became more widely recognized, and as Bitcoin itself faced scalability challenges and ideological debates, the cryptocurrency landscape began to diversify rapidly. This diversification was marked by the emergence of "altcoins," alternative cryptocurrencies designed to address perceived shortcomings of Bitcoin or to explore new functionalities and use cases. CoinMarketCap, a leading cryptocurrency data aggregator, lists thousands of active cryptocurrencies, reflecting the sheer scale of this proliferation. This explosion of altcoins led to a corresponding fragmentation of crypto communities, as individuals and groups gravitated towards projects that aligned with their specific interests, technological preferences, or investment strategies.
One of the earliest and most significant forks in the Bitcoin community arose from debates surrounding Bitcoin's block size limit. As Bitcoin's popularity grew, transaction volume increased, leading to longer confirmation times and higher transaction fees. This scalability issue sparked intense debates within the community, with different factions advocating for different solutions, including increasing the block size or implementing layer-2 scaling solutions like the Lightning Network. The Bitcoin block size debate, documented extensively in online forums and academic papers like "The Blocksize War" by Jonathan Bier, ultimately led to the creation of Bitcoin Cash (BCH) in 2017, a hard fork of Bitcoin that increased the block size to accommodate more transactions. This event exemplified the growing fragmentation within the Bitcoin community and the emergence of distinct altcoin communities with their own technical roadmaps and ideological orientations.
Beyond scalability concerns, altcoins emerged to explore a wide range of functionalities and use cases beyond Bitcoin's primary focus on peer-to-peer digital cash. Ethereum, launched in 2015, stands out as a pivotal development in this diversification. Vitalik Buterin, the founder of Ethereum, envisioned a more general-purpose blockchain platform capable of supporting decentralized applications (dApps) and smart contracts. The Ethereum whitepaper, "A Next-Generation Smart Contract and Decentralized Application Platform," articulated this vision, proposing a Turing-complete virtual machine that would allow developers to build a wide array of decentralized applications on top of the Ethereum blockchain. The launch of Ethereum gave rise to a vibrant and diverse community of developers, entrepreneurs, and users, focused on building and utilizing dApps across various sectors, including decentralized finance (DeFi), non-fungible tokens (NFTs), and decentralized autonomous organizations (DAOs). According to data from DappRadar, a platform tracking decentralized applications, Ethereum hosts the vast majority of dApps and DeFi protocols, highlighting its central role in the altcoin ecosystem.
The proliferation of altcoins also reflected different ideological and philosophical perspectives within the broader crypto space. Some altcoins, like Monero and Zcash, prioritized enhanced privacy and anonymity features, building upon cryptographic techniques like ring signatures and zero-knowledge proofs. Monero's website emphasizes its commitment to privacy as a fundamental right, attracting users who value transactional confidentiality. Other altcoins focused on specific industry applications, such as Ripple (XRP), which initially aimed to facilitate cross-border payments for financial institutions, and VeChain, which focused on supply chain management and traceability. Ripple's website highlights its partnerships with financial institutions, reflecting its focus on enterprise adoption. This specialization by industry and use case further contributed to the fragmentation of crypto communities, with distinct communities forming around each altcoin project, each with its own set of priorities, values, and technical expertise.
The emergence of Initial Coin Offerings (ICOs) in 2017 and 2018 further accelerated the proliferation of altcoins and the fragmentation of crypto communities. ICOs provided a novel fundraising mechanism for new cryptocurrency projects, allowing them to raise capital directly from the public by issuing and selling tokens. A study by Ernst & Young (EY) in 2018, "Initial Coin Offerings (ICOs): To ICO or not to ICO," analyzed the ICO landscape, highlighting both the potential and the risks associated with this new fundraising model. The ICO boom led to an explosion of new altcoin projects, many of which attracted significant community interest and investment. However, the ICO craze also attracted scams and projects with dubious fundamentals, leading to significant losses for many investors and contributing to a period of market correction in 2018. Research by the Wall Street Journal in 2018, "Hundreds of Bitcoin Wannabes Have Vanished," documented the high failure rate of ICO projects, underscoring the risks associated with investing in early-stage altcoins.
Despite the risks and volatility, the altcoin boom and the ICO phenomenon undeniably broadened the scope of the crypto ecosystem and fostered the growth of diverse and specialized crypto communities. These communities often coalesce around specific technological innovations, use cases, or investment theses. For example, communities formed around DeFi protocols like Uniswap and Aave are focused on decentralized financial services, while communities centered on NFT platforms like OpenSea and Rarible are driven by the burgeoning market for digital collectibles and art. These specialized communities often exhibit a high degree of technical expertise and active participation in project governance and development. As described by Primavera De Filippi and Smaranda Gjorgjiu in their book "Blockchain and Web 3.0" (2021), this fragmentation of crypto communities reflects a broader trend towards specialization and niche markets within the rapidly evolving crypto space, mirroring patterns observed in other technology-driven industries. The challenge for the future of crypto culture and community lies in fostering greater interoperability and collaboration across these fragmented communities, while still preserving the diversity and innovation that have characterized the altcoin ecosystem.
Social Media and Crypto Culture: Twitter, Reddit, and the Rise of Crypto-Native Platforms
Social media platforms have become indispensable arenas for the formation, evolution, and propagation of crypto culture and community. Platforms like Twitter, Reddit, Telegram, Discord, and YouTube have emerged as primary channels for crypto enthusiasts to connect, share information, debate ideas, and organize collective action. These platforms have profoundly shaped the dynamics of crypto communities, influencing everything from price discovery and market sentiment to project governance and cultural trends. Research by Meltwater, a social media monitoring company, in their 2021 report "The State of Social Media for Cryptocurrency," indicates a significant surge in crypto-related conversations on social media platforms, particularly during periods of market volatility and major industry events. The accessibility and immediacy of social media have democratized access to crypto information and community participation, but also introduced new challenges related to misinformation, hype cycles, and tribalism.
Twitter has become arguably the most influential social media platform for crypto culture. Its real-time nature, character limits, and hashtag system make it ideal for disseminating breaking news, expressing opinions, and engaging in public debates within the crypto space. Key opinion leaders (KOLs) and influencers on Crypto Twitter (CT) wield significant influence over market sentiment and community narratives. A study by the University of Southern California in 2020, "Cryptocurrency Market Manipulation on Social Media," analyzed the impact of Twitter sentiment on cryptocurrency price movements, finding a correlation between positive or negative tweets and short-term price fluctuations. Crypto projects and founders actively utilize Twitter to announce developments, engage with their communities, and manage public relations. Elon Musk's tweets about Dogecoin, for example, have demonstrably impacted the price of the cryptocurrency, illustrating the potent influence of social media on crypto markets. However, the open and often unfiltered nature of Twitter also makes it susceptible to misinformation, scams, and coordinated manipulation campaigns. Reports from the Federal Trade Commission (FTC) in 2022 indicate a significant increase in crypto-related scams targeting social media users, highlighting the risks associated with relying solely on social media for crypto information and investment decisions.
Reddit, particularly subreddits like r/Bitcoin, r/Cryptocurrency, and r/Ethereum, provides a more forum-based and community-driven platform for crypto discussions. Reddit's upvote and downvote system, combined with moderation by community members, helps to curate content and surface valuable discussions. Subreddits serve as hubs for specific crypto communities, allowing users to delve into in-depth discussions about technical aspects, project updates, investment strategies, and community governance. Analysis of Reddit data using natural language processing techniques, as demonstrated in research by Somin Wadhwa et al. in their 2021 paper "Sentiment Analysis of Cryptocurrency Discussions on Reddit," reveals valuable insights into community sentiment, emerging trends, and potential risks within the crypto space. Reddit also serves as a platform for decentralized governance experiments, such as r/Cryptocurrency's Community Points system, which rewards users for contributing valuable content and participating in community discussions. However, Reddit communities can also be prone to echo chambers and groupthink, reinforcing existing biases and limiting exposure to diverse perspectives. Studies on online community dynamics, such as "Net Delusion" by Evgeny Morozov (2011), caution against the potential for online communities to become insular and resistant to dissenting viewpoints.
Telegram and Discord have emerged as popular messaging platforms for crypto communities, particularly for project-specific groups and decentralized autonomous organizations (DAOs). These platforms offer real-time communication, group chat functionality, and bot integrations, facilitating instant updates, community coordination, and project governance discussions. Telegram's encrypted messaging and large group capacity make it attractive for privacy-conscious crypto users and large-scale community management. Discord's server structure, channel organization, and role-based access control provide more granular control over community interactions and governance processes, making it particularly suitable for DAOs and project teams. Data from Similarweb, a website analytics company, indicates a significant increase in traffic to crypto-related Telegram and Discord groups, reflecting their growing importance in the crypto community landscape. However, the ephemeral nature of chat-based communication and the potential for information overload can make it challenging to track and synthesize information within these platforms. Research on online communication patterns, such as "Alone Together" by Sherry Turkle (2011), raises concerns about the potential for constant connectivity and fragmented attention to hinder deeper engagement and critical thinking.
YouTube and other video-sharing platforms have become crucial channels for crypto education, analysis, and entertainment. Crypto YouTubers produce a wide range of content, from introductory explanations of blockchain technology and cryptocurrencies to in-depth market analysis and project reviews. Data from Social Blade, a social media analytics platform, shows the rapid growth of crypto-focused YouTube channels, indicating the increasing demand for video-based crypto content. YouTube serves as an accessible entry point for newcomers to the crypto space, providing visual and auditory learning resources that can complement text-based information. However, the algorithmic nature of YouTube's recommendation system can also create filter bubbles and amplify sensationalist or biased content. Concerns about algorithmic bias and misinformation on YouTube have been widely documented in research and media reports, highlighting the need for critical evaluation of information consumed on video-sharing platforms.
The rise of crypto-native social platforms, such as Mirror.xyz and Farcaster, represents a further evolution in the intersection of social media and crypto culture. Mirror.xyz is a decentralized publishing platform built on Ethereum, allowing writers to monetize their content through NFTs and engage directly with their audience in a Web3 environment. Farcaster is a decentralized social network protocol, aiming to create a more censorship-resistant and user-owned alternative to traditional social media platforms. These crypto-native platforms seek to align the incentives of creators and users, leveraging blockchain technology to address some of the limitations and challenges associated with centralized social media platforms. Proponents of Web3 social media argue that these platforms can foster more equitable and resilient crypto communities, empowering users and creators while mitigating the risks of censorship and platform dependency. However, the adoption of crypto-native social platforms is still in its early stages, and their long-term impact on crypto culture and community remains to be seen. Predictions about the future of social media, as outlined in "The Social Dilemma," a Netflix documentary (2020), emphasize the need for platforms that prioritize user well-being and responsible content moderation, principles that crypto-native platforms are attempting to incorporate into their design.
Decentralized Autonomous Organizations (DAOs) and the Future of Community Governance: Shifting Power Dynamics
Decentralized Autonomous Organizations (DAOs) represent a radical departure from traditional organizational structures, offering a potentially transformative model for community governance and collective action within the crypto space and beyond. DAOs are organizations governed by rules encoded in smart contracts on a blockchain, rather than by hierarchical management structures. These rules typically dictate how decisions are made, how funds are managed, and how resources are allocated within the organization. DAO members typically hold tokens that grant them voting rights, allowing them to participate in governance proposals and shape the direction of the organization. Research by Deloitte in their 2021 report "Decentralized Autonomous Organizations (DAOs): Revolutionizing Business or Just Another Fad?" explores the potential of DAOs to disrupt traditional business models and governance structures. DAOs are increasingly being adopted by crypto projects, communities, and even traditional organizations seeking to leverage the benefits of decentralization, transparency, and community participation.
The core principles of DAOs are transparency, decentralization, and community ownership. All DAO operations, including proposals, voting records, and financial transactions, are typically recorded on a public blockchain, making them auditable and transparent. Decision-making power is distributed among token holders, rather than concentrated in the hands of a few individuals or executives. DAOs aim to empower community members to actively participate in governance and decision-making processes, fostering a sense of ownership and shared responsibility. Primavera De Filippi and Aaron Wright, in their book "Blockchain and the Law" (2018), emphasize the potential of DAOs to create more democratic and participatory organizational structures. However, the practical implementation of these principles in DAOs is still evolving, and challenges remain in areas such as governance design, security, and legal frameworks.
Different types of DAOs have emerged, catering to various purposes and community structures. Protocol DAOs govern blockchain protocols and decentralized applications, managing protocol upgrades, treasury funds, and community grants. MakerDAO, governing the DAI stablecoin, is a prominent example of a protocol DAO. Investment DAOs pool capital from members to collectively invest in crypto assets or other ventures. SyndicateDAO is a platform facilitating the creation of investment DAOs. Grant DAOs distribute funds to support projects and initiatives within a specific ecosystem or community. Gitcoin Grants is a well-known example of a grant DAO supporting open-source software development. Social DAOs focus on building and managing online communities, often centered around shared interests, values, or creative pursuits. Friends With Benefits (FWB) is a prominent example of a social DAO. Service DAOs offer services or products to clients, with governance and ownership distributed among service providers and community members. LexDAO is an example of a service DAO providing legal services in the crypto space. Analysis of DAO structures and governance models, as conducted by Aragon, a platform for creating and managing DAOs, in their "DAO Landscape Report 2022," reveals the diversity and evolving nature of DAO organizations.
DAO governance mechanisms typically involve proposal submission, voting, and execution. DAO members can submit proposals for changes to the DAO's rules, treasury allocation, or project direction. Token holders then vote on these proposals, with voting power usually proportional to the number of tokens held. If a proposal receives sufficient votes, the smart contracts automatically execute the proposed changes. Governance frameworks like Aragon Govern, Snapshot, and Tally provide tools and infrastructure for DAOs to manage their governance processes. Research on DAO governance, such as "The DAO Handbook" by Aragon, highlights the importance of designing robust and transparent governance mechanisms to ensure effective decision-making and prevent malicious actors from manipulating the system. Challenges in DAO governance include voter apathy, low participation rates, and the potential for whale dominance, where large token holders disproportionately influence voting outcomes. Studies on collective action and governance in online communities, such as "Governing the Commons" by Elinor Ostrom (1990), offer insights into designing effective governance mechanisms that promote broad participation and equitable outcomes.
DAOs are experimenting with various governance models to address these challenges and enhance community participation. Quadratic voting, implemented by Gitcoin Grants, aims to reduce the influence of wealthy voters by making votes more costly as more votes are cast. Delegated voting allows token holders to delegate their voting power to trusted community members or experts, increasing participation and expertise in governance decisions. Liquid democracy combines elements of direct democracy and representative democracy, allowing token holders to either vote directly on proposals or delegate their votes to representatives, with the option to recall their delegation at any time. Research on voting systems and mechanism design, such as "Designing Digital Democracy" by Beth Noveck (2009), explores various approaches to enhance participation, fairness, and representativeness in online governance systems.
The legal and regulatory status of DAOs remains a complex and evolving area. Traditional legal frameworks are not well-suited to accommodate decentralized organizations governed by smart contracts. Some jurisdictions are exploring legal frameworks for DAOs, such as the Wyoming DAO law in the United States, which recognizes DAOs as a new type of limited liability company (LLC). Legal analysis of DAOs, such as "DAOs and the Law" by Miles Jennings and Gabriel Shapiro (2021), highlights the legal uncertainties and challenges associated with DAOs, particularly regarding liability, taxation, and regulatory compliance. The lack of legal clarity can hinder the adoption of DAOs by traditional organizations and raise concerns about the legal protection of DAO members. International regulatory bodies, such as the Financial Action Task Force (FATF), are also considering the implications of DAOs for anti-money laundering (AML) and counter-terrorism financing (CTF) regulations. The evolving regulatory landscape will significantly impact the future development and adoption of DAOs.
Despite the challenges, DAOs represent a significant evolution in crypto community governance and have the potential to reshape organizational structures beyond the crypto space. As DAOs mature and governance mechanisms are refined, they could foster more participatory, transparent, and community-driven organizations. Predictions about the future of work and organizations, as outlined in "Reinventing Organizations" by Frederic Laloux (2014), suggest a shift towards more self-managing and purpose-driven organizations, principles that align with the ethos of DAOs. The success of DAOs in the long term will depend on addressing the governance challenges, navigating the evolving regulatory landscape, and demonstrating their ability to effectively manage complex projects and organizations in a decentralized and community-owned manner.
NFTs, Metaverse, and New Forms of Crypto Socialization: Immersive and Experiential Communities
Non-Fungible Tokens (NFTs) and the Metaverse are introducing new dimensions to crypto culture and community, moving beyond purely financial and technological interactions towards more immersive, experiential, and culturally-driven forms of socialization. NFTs, representing unique digital assets, have expanded the scope of crypto beyond currencies and decentralized finance, encompassing art, collectibles, gaming, virtual land, and digital identities. The Metaverse, encompassing persistent, shared virtual worlds, provides new spaces for crypto communities to interact, socialize, and build shared experiences. These developments are fostering new types of crypto communities centered around shared ownership of digital assets, participation in virtual worlds, and engagement with digital culture. Reports from market research firms like NonFungible.com and DappRadar indicate the rapid growth of the NFT market and the increasing interest in Metaverse platforms, highlighting their growing significance in the crypto ecosystem.
NFT communities are often characterized by strong social bonds and shared cultural identities. NFT projects like Bored Ape Yacht Club (BAYC) and CryptoPunks have cultivated highly engaged communities of collectors who identify with the project's aesthetic, values, and social status. Owning a specific NFT from a popular collection often serves as a status symbol and a membership badge within these communities, granting access to exclusive online and offline events, private Discord channels, and collaborative projects. Research on online communities and virtual identity, such as "Life on the Screen" by Sherry Turkle (1995), explores the psychological and social dynamics of identity formation and community building in digital spaces. NFT communities often leverage social media platforms, particularly Twitter and Discord, to maintain close communication, organize community events, and coordinate collective actions. Analysis of NFT community interactions on social media, as conducted by Dune Analytics, a blockchain data platform, reveals the high level of engagement and social activity within these communities.
The Metaverse provides persistent virtual environments where crypto communities can interact in real-time, creating shared experiences and strengthening social bonds. Metaverse platforms like Decentraland and The Sandbox are built on blockchain technology and integrate NFTs, allowing users to own virtual land, create digital assets, and participate in decentralized economies. Crypto communities are establishing virtual headquarters, organizing virtual events, and building social spaces within these Metaverse platforms. Concerts, art exhibitions, virtual conferences, and community gatherings are increasingly taking place in Metaverse environments, offering new ways for crypto communities to connect and socialize. Reports from Metaverse analytics firms like MetaMetric Solutions indicate the growing user base and economic activity within Metaverse platforms, suggesting their increasing importance as social spaces for crypto communities. Studies on virtual worlds and online interaction, such as "Avatar Dreams" by Sherry Turkle (2011), examine the psychological and social implications of inhabiting and interacting in virtual environments.
NFTs and the Metaverse are blurring the lines between the digital and physical worlds, creating new opportunities for hybrid forms of crypto community interaction. NFT-gated access to real-world events and experiences is becoming increasingly common, allowing NFT holders to unlock exclusive perks and benefits in the physical world. NFT communities are organizing in-person meetups, conferences, and social gatherings, leveraging NFTs as digital membership cards and community identifiers. The integration of NFTs and Metaverse platforms with augmented reality (AR) and virtual reality (VR) technologies is further enhancing the immersive and experiential nature of crypto community interactions. Predictions about the future of the Metaverse and extended reality (XR), as outlined in "Ready Player One" by Ernest Cline (2011) and "Snow Crash" by Neal Stephenson (1992), envision a future where digital and physical realities are increasingly intertwined, creating new forms of social interaction and community building.
Gaming NFTs and play-to-earn (P2E) gaming models are creating new types of crypto communities centered around shared gaming experiences and economic incentives. P2E games like Axie Infinity and The Sandbox allow players to earn cryptocurrency and NFTs by playing the game, creating economic opportunities and fostering communities of players who are both gamers and crypto enthusiasts. NFT-based gaming communities often exhibit strong player-to-player interactions, guild formations, and decentralized governance structures. Data from P2E gaming platforms like Yield Guild Games indicates the significant growth of P2E gaming communities and the economic impact of P2E gaming models in developing countries. Research on gaming communities and online economies, such as "Reality is Broken" by Jane McGonigal (2011), explores the motivational factors and social dynamics within gaming communities and the potential for gamification to drive engagement and collective action.
Decentralized identities (DIDs) and verifiable credentials (VCs) built on blockchain technology are enabling new forms of digital identity and reputation management within crypto communities. NFT-based avatars and profile pictures are becoming common forms of digital self-expression and community affiliation. DID solutions are being explored to create portable and self-sovereign digital identities that can be used across different crypto platforms and Metaverse environments. VCs can be used to verify credentials, skills, and reputation within crypto communities, enabling more trust and transparency in online interactions. Predictions about the future of digital identity and self-sovereign identity, as outlined in "The Age of Surveillance Capitalism" by Shoshana Zuboff (2019), emphasize the importance of user control and privacy in the digital identity landscape, principles that are central to decentralized identity solutions.
However, the rapid growth of NFTs and the Metaverse also presents challenges for crypto communities. Concerns about environmental impact, speculative bubbles, and accessibility are being raised regarding NFT markets. The high cost of entry to some NFT communities and Metaverse platforms can exclude individuals from participating. Issues of moderation, safety, and governance within Metaverse environments need to be addressed to ensure inclusive and positive community experiences. Ethical considerations regarding digital ownership, virtual identity, and the potential for digital inequality in the Metaverse need to be carefully considered. Critical analyses of the Metaverse and Web3, such as "My First Impressions of Web3" by Moxie Marlinspike (2022), raise important questions about the decentralization claims and the potential for centralization and control within these emerging technologies.
Despite these challenges, NFTs and the Metaverse are undeniably shaping the future of crypto culture and community, creating more diverse, immersive, and experiential forms of socialization. As these technologies mature and become more accessible, they have the potential to foster even richer and more vibrant crypto communities, extending the reach and impact of crypto culture beyond the realm of finance and technology into the broader cultural and social landscape. Predictions about the future of community and social interaction in the digital age, as outlined in "Community: The Structure of Belonging" by Peter Block (2008), emphasize the importance of shared purpose, meaningful connection, and participatory governance in building strong and resilient communities, principles that are increasingly being explored and implemented within crypto communities in the age of NFTs and the Metaverse.
Regulatory Landscape and its Influence on Crypto Communities: Navigating Uncertainty and Compliance
The evolving regulatory landscape poses a significant and multifaceted influence on the future of crypto culture and community. Governments and regulatory bodies worldwide are grappling with how to regulate cryptocurrencies, NFTs, DAOs, and other aspects of the crypto ecosystem, seeking to balance innovation with consumer protection, financial stability, and national security concerns. The regulatory approaches vary significantly across jurisdictions, creating a complex and often fragmented global regulatory landscape. Reports from organizations like the Financial Stability Board (FSB) and the International Monetary Fund (IMF) highlight the global regulatory challenges and the need for international cooperation in crypto regulation. Regulatory actions, or the lack thereof, can significantly impact the development, adoption, and social dynamics of crypto communities.
Regulatory uncertainty and ambiguity can stifle innovation and hinder the growth of crypto communities. Unclear or conflicting regulations create compliance challenges for crypto projects and businesses, making it difficult to operate legally and attract investment. Fear of regulatory crackdowns can discourage participation in crypto communities and drive activity underground or offshore. Surveys of crypto businesses, such as the "Global Crypto Regulation Report" by Coinfirm in 2022, indicate regulatory uncertainty as a major concern for the industry, impacting investment decisions and business planning. Research on the impact of regulation on innovation, such as "The Regulatory Review" by the Penn Program on Regulation, emphasizes the importance of clear, predictable, and proportionate regulations to foster innovation and economic growth.
Specific regulatory areas of concern for crypto communities include securities regulations, anti-money laundering (AML) and counter-terrorism financing (CTF) regulations, taxation, and data privacy regulations. Securities regulators, such as the Securities and Exchange Commission (SEC) in the United States, are scrutinizing the issuance and sale of crypto tokens to determine if they qualify as securities, which would subject them to securities laws and registration requirements. Enforcement actions by the SEC against crypto projects for unregistered securities offerings, as documented in SEC press releases and legal filings, have had a chilling effect on the ICO and token sale market and raised concerns within crypto communities. AML and CTF regulations require crypto exchanges and other virtual asset service providers (VASPs) to implement know-your-customer (KYC) and transaction monitoring procedures to prevent illicit activities. Compliance with AML/CTF regulations can be costly and technically challenging for crypto businesses, particularly decentralized exchanges (DEXs) and peer-to-peer platforms. Reports from the Financial Action Task Force (FATF) on virtual assets highlight the importance of AML/CTF compliance in the crypto space and provide guidance for regulatory implementation.
Taxation of cryptocurrencies and NFTs is another area of regulatory complexity. Tax authorities worldwide are developing guidance on how to classify and tax crypto assets, with approaches varying from treating them as property to treating them as currencies or financial assets. Tax reporting requirements for crypto transactions can be complex and burdensome for crypto users, particularly in jurisdictions with limited guidance or unclear rules. Reports from the Organisation for Economic Co-operation and Development (OECD) on the taxation of virtual currencies highlight the international challenges in crypto taxation and the need for coordinated approaches. Data privacy regulations, such as the General Data Protection Regulation (GDPR) in Europe and the California Consumer Privacy Act (CCPA) in the United States, impact crypto projects that collect and process personal data. Compliance with data privacy regulations requires crypto projects to implement data protection measures and provide users with control over their personal data. Research on data privacy and blockchain, such as "Blockchain and GDPR Compliance" by the European Union Blockchain Observatory & Forum, explores the challenges and potential solutions for reconciling blockchain technology with data privacy regulations.
Regulatory sandboxes and innovation hubs are emerging as mechanisms for regulators to engage with crypto projects and foster responsible innovation. Regulatory sandboxes provide a controlled environment for crypto companies to test innovative products and services under regulatory supervision. Innovation hubs serve as platforms for dialogue and collaboration between regulators, crypto businesses, and other stakeholders to explore regulatory challenges and potential solutions. Reports from organizations like the Global Financial Innovation Network (GFIN) highlight the role of regulatory sandboxes and innovation hubs in promoting responsible crypto innovation. These initiatives can help to bridge the gap between regulators and crypto communities, fostering a more collaborative and constructive regulatory dialogue.
Decentralized governance and DAOs pose unique regulatory challenges. Traditional regulatory frameworks are designed for organizations with centralized control and legal personality, which may not be applicable to DAOs operating in a decentralized and autonomous manner. Determining legal liability and regulatory responsibility in DAOs is a complex issue, particularly in the absence of clear legal frameworks for DAOs. Legal analyses of DAO regulation, such as "Regulating DAOs" by Aaron Wright and Primavera De Filippi (2021), explore potential regulatory approaches for DAOs, ranging from adapting existing legal frameworks to creating new legal entities specifically for DAOs. The evolving regulatory treatment of DAOs will significantly impact their adoption and operation, shaping the future of decentralized governance in the crypto space.
International regulatory coordination and harmonization are crucial to address the global nature of crypto markets and communities. Lack of regulatory harmonization can create regulatory arbitrage, where crypto businesses relocate to jurisdictions with more favorable regulations, undermining regulatory effectiveness. International bodies like the FSB and the FATF are promoting international cooperation and information sharing on crypto regulation. Bilateral and multilateral agreements between countries on crypto regulation can help to create a more level playing field and reduce regulatory fragmentation. Reports from the FSB and the IMF emphasize the need for international cooperation to address the global risks and challenges posed by crypto assets. The degree of international regulatory coordination will significantly impact the global development and interconnectedness of crypto communities.
The regulatory landscape is not merely an external constraint on crypto communities; it also shapes internal community dynamics and values. Regulatory scrutiny can foster greater self-regulation and compliance within crypto communities, promoting responsible behavior and mitigating risks. Debates about regulatory approaches and compliance strategies often become central to community discussions, influencing community narratives and ideological orientations. Advocacy efforts by crypto communities to shape regulatory outcomes can strengthen community cohesion and political engagement. Research on the sociology of regulation, such as "The Regulatory State" by Julia Black (2002), highlights the interactive and dynamic relationship between regulation and the regulated community, where regulation not only controls but also shapes the behavior and identity of the community.
Navigating the evolving regulatory landscape is a critical challenge and opportunity for crypto communities. Proactive engagement with regulators, promotion of responsible innovation, and development of compliance solutions are essential for fostering a sustainable and thriving crypto ecosystem. Education and awareness within crypto communities about regulatory requirements and compliance best practices are crucial for responsible community participation. Collaboration and dialogue between crypto communities and regulators are necessary to shape a regulatory framework that balances innovation with consumer protection and financial stability. Predictions about the future of crypto regulation, as outlined in "Cryptoassets: The Innovative Investor's Guide to Bitcoin and Beyond" by Chris Burniske and Jack Tatar (2017), suggest that a pragmatic and balanced regulatory approach will be essential for unlocking the full potential of crypto technologies and fostering the long-term growth of crypto communities. The future of crypto culture and community will be inextricably linked to how effectively these communities navigate and shape the evolving regulatory landscape.
